According to Dr. Carol Tavris, a social psychologist known for her work on cognitive dissonance, this scenario is a classic example of how minor self-justifications can spiral into entrenched behavior. The initial lie created cognitive dissonance: the OP held the belief ‘I am an honest person’ while acting as ‘a person who is lying about their origin.’ To resolve this internal conflict without the immediate anxiety of confessing, the OP reinforced the lie by watching accent videos and avoiding situations where the truth would surface. Each subsequent day pretending to be British served to justify the previous day’s pretense, making the exit strategy appear exponentially riskier.

The dynamic with the friend highlights the concept of ‘impression management’ fueled by anxiety. The OP was primarily managing their perceived audience (the cute friend) rather than fostering authentic connection. The friend’s reaction—revealing he had suspected the truth for years but chose not to confront it to save the OP embarrassment—shows that the perceived social cost of the lie was likely much higher in the OP’s mind than in reality. This is a common pattern where individuals overestimate the severity of others’ judgments.

The appropriate action, in this case, was the confession, although it was prompted by discovery rather than proactive choice. A constructive recommendation for handling similar high-anxiety situations is to practice ‘micro-confessions’ immediately after a minor lapse. For instance, after saying ‘I’m from London,’ a quick, self-deprecating follow-up like, ‘Just kidding, I was talking in a silly accent for my friend, I’m actually from [State],’ immediately defuses the situation, manages social anxiety by facing the fear directly, and prevents the escalation into a long-term, identity-threatening fabrication.
